Background
Lysozymes have primarily a bacteriolytic function; those in tissues and body fluids are associated with the monocyte- macrophage system and enhance the activity of immunoagents.

Immunogen
This LYZ antibody is generated from a rabbit immunized with a KLH conjugated synthetic peptide between 119-154 amino acids from the C-terminal region of human LYZ.
